Henk Corporaal
Henk Corporaal is Associate Professor in Computer Architecture at the Delft University of Technology (TUD). At this university he managed several research projects in the areas of computer architecture, processor hardware design, and parallel processing. One of his main projects, the MOVE project, concerns the automatic generation of hardware and software for embedded systems. Corporaal has a Ph.D. in Electrical Engineering from the TUD and a M.Sc. in Mathematics and Physics from the University of Groningen (The Netherlands). He lectures undergraduate, graduate and postgraduate courses on computer programming, computer architecture and parallel processing at the TUD and the Advanced School for Computing and Imaging. He has written numerous publications in different areas, including computer architecture, runtime support for high level languages, MIMD computing, concurrent simulation, neural networks, and code generation for Instruction Level Parallel processors. He is the author of the book "Transport Triggered Architectures" (published by John Wiley).
